Abstract
This study investigated whether the administration of resolvin D1 to rats with endotoxininduced uveitis (EIU) ameliorates the immuno-inflammatory profile of the eye. 24 h after the administration of 200 μg LPS into the footpad of Sprague-Dawley rats, severe changes of the structure of the eye occurred concomitantly with a severe inflammatory and immune response. These latter included strong infiltration of PMN leukocytes CD11b+ T-lymphocytes CD4+ and CD8+ within the eye and a significant release of the cytokines/chemokines TNF-alpha, CXCL8, and RANTES too. Bolus of resolvin D1 (RvD1; 10–100–1000 ng/kg in 200 μL of sterile saline via the tail vein) significantly and dose-dependently (i) reduced the development of the ocular derangement caused by LPS; (ii) reduced the clinical score attributed to EIU; (iii) reduced the protein concentration and myeloperoxidase activity (MPO) in aqueous humor (AqH); and (iv) reduced neutrophils, T-lymphocytes, and cytokines within the eye.
